GHR Technology Salary

As of April 2026, the average annual salary for employees at GHR Technology in the United States is $95,143.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$46. Salaries at GHR Technology typically range from $83,626 to $107,648 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About GHR Technology
GHR Technology partners with healthcare organizations, health insurance companies, hospital systems, and corporations to fill their technology staffing needs. The company is based in Plymouth Meeting, Pennsylvania.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Philadelphia?

Understanding the cost of living near Philadelphia is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at GHR Technology.
Philadelphia's Cost of Living Index is approximately 101.2 (1.2% more expensive than US average; 4.2% more than PA average). Major historic city, housing varies by neighborhood but can be high in Center City. SEPTA. When planning your budget based on a salary from GHR Technology,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,400 - $2,200+ A significant portion of GHR Technology sal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$96 (SEPTA TransPass monthly)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$630 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$730+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,866 - $4,566+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
